Why wouldn't it be enjoyable on the felt? Aren't all chips expected to get dirty? How would the color make it dirty?
A dirty stack isn't one that is necessarily soiled but a case where a chip from one denomination gets mixed in or mistaken with another either in a stack or in a pot.

The point @JeepologyOffroad is trying to make is having chips with many different spot colors that are otherwise similar to the spots (or base) colors of other chips make this easier to happen.

The spots should ideally be different than the base or spot colors of the chips in "nearby" denominations (meaning one level higher or lower) to help minimize this and ideall won't use the same spot colors across all denominations as you have in these examples. Spots are there to help distinguish one chip denomination from another.
